Luke: Focus on Jesus - The Plan of Proximity


May 25, 2025Jason SandersonLuke: Focus on JesusLuke 6:12-19

Notes Outline

OUTLINE:

  • Proximity to His Presence – Luke 6:12 “In these days he went out to the mountain to pray, and all night he continued in prayer to God.”
    • Jesus withdrew to be alone with the Father, modeling that intimacy with God precedes clarity in direction. The Father’s presence was sought in solitude, reminding us that divine guidance is found in a quiet relationship with God. Before calling others close, Jesus drew near to the Father.
  • Proximity to His People – Luke 6:13–16 “And when day came, he called his disciples and chose from them twelve, whom he named apostles...”
    • After being with the Father, Jesus moved toward people. He chose twelve to be with Him and carry His mission forward. These men came from radically different backgrounds, yet Jesus called them into shared community. Proximity to His people is where formation, purpose, and grace intertwine.
  • Proximity to His Power – Luke 6:17–19 “And the crowd sought to touch him, for power came out from him and healed them all.”
    • As people gathered around Jesus, His power was on display. Healing, restoration, and deliverance weren’t earned; they were experienced through nearness. The closer they got, the more they encountered His power. Proximity to Jesus heals both body and soul.
